Born in London in 1955, Con Coughlin has built a distinguished career as a journalist and expert in international politics.
His most acclaimed work, Saddam: King of Terror, is a fundamental reference for understanding the Iraqi dictator.
Throughout his career, he has published a total of 12 books exploring complex themes of history and geopolitics.
His analysis focuses particularly on key 20th-century figures, such as Ayatollah Khomeini, and the rise of Islamic fundamentalism.
As an expert in the field, Coughlin combines the rigor of investigative journalism with a deep narrative on power and government.
